QUICKIE REVIEW - The Virgin's Revenge by Dee Tenorio

The Virgin's Revenge by Dee Tenorio
If you can't beat 'em...seduce 'em

Amanda Jackman’s love life is the stuff dreams are made of...which is fitting, because it’s all in her head. Thanks to six oversized, overbearing brothers who treat her like the family jewel, she’s lived in a padded little box.

Determined to get a life before she needs a padded little cell, she sets out to throw off the yoke and live on her own terms. Except she seriously underestimates the lengths to which her brothers will go to keep her safe and sound.

Cole Engstrom’s life might just be at an end. Cornered by all six of the massive Jackmans—men he normally considers his friends—he learns he’s their choice to marry their sister...or else. Make that first choice, but not the last.

Rather than watch Amanda’s brothers club their way through potential mates, Cole figures it’s best to just play along for a while and buy her some time to find a man of her own. It’s a good plan. Until Amanda figures it out—and decides he’s the one to relieve her of her “sheltered little virgin” status. One seduction at a time...
ebook, 253 pages
Published July 3rd 2012 by Samhain Publishing, Ltd.
ISBN139781609288662
series Rancho Del Cielo #4

My Rambles:
The first thing I should say is that this is the first Rancho Del Cielo book I have read in the series. There were some things that I missed out on, but I think this book had enough within that made it good enough to be a standalone.
The second thing I need to say? You can always count on Dee Tenorio to write good contemporary!
This story? I did find the beginning a bit hard to get into. But once I did get in it was wonderful.
Funny with a touch of angst.
And the brothers? They ALL deserve a smack up the side of the head!!

3.5/5
